英文摘要Organic hydroperoxides are a class of biologically significant molecules that exist ubiquitously in nature. The ideal synthesis is direct hydroperoxidation of C(sp3)-H bonds, which remained a substantial challenge, particularly for the unactivated C(sp3)-H bonds. Inspired by the bio-catalysis of cyclooxygenase, a direct and site-selective photochemical hydroperoxidation of unactivated C(sp3)-H bonds was thus developed involving O2 as the oxidant and bromine radical as the catalyst. This method, demonstrated by plenty of substrates (63 examples) enables the late-stage functionalization of diverse types of natural products and/or drugs, such as terpenoids, amino acids, peptides, sugars and phosphonates.
